The Collaborating Political Parties says it believes the increase in criminal activities in Liberia is as a result of the unprecedented economic hardship and ever-increasing illegal drug trafficking and selling in the country.
The CPP statement is in response to the clash between officers of the Liberia National Police and supposed criminals in Duala in which three persons were feared dead with others injured.
According to a statement issued by the CPP on Wednesday, November 24, 2021, said, drug abuse by those disadvantaged youths has also turned them into hardened marauding criminals with no apparent actions taken by the government to rehabilitate and they reintegrated into society.
The CPP noted that multiple reports have suggested that three persons died as a result of the shootout in Duala and that it is very concerned with the increased loss of lives through any violent action. The release under the signature of CPP Head of Secretariat Mo Ali stated that the CPP takes note of the police and other security agencies for undertaking their responsibility to begin to fight crimes and raid criminal’s hideouts and ghettos, but this venture is coming at a time when the government has failed to protect the state and its people.
The CPP called on the government to also divert its attention to funding rehabilitation programs for disadvantaged youths, with rehabilitation programs initiated across the country.
